Nine pre-weighed coupons, three of each substrate per cleaner, were contaminated with one gram of Hucker's soil using a handheld swab and air-dried at room temperature (68 F) for 24 hours. The contaminated coupons were weighed to record dirty weights before placing three coupons per cleaner of the same substrate into a Gardner Straight Line Washability (SLW) unit. A Kimberly-Clark Wypal reinforced paper towel was attached to the cleaning sled. The Wypal and each coupon were treated with three sprays of the product and cleaned for 20 cycles (~30 seconds of cleaning). Cleaned coupons were wiped once with a dry paper towel before the final weights were taken.

* Plastic coupon's final weight was lower than the initial weight.

Some soil was left on the painted metal.

Bioneat is an effective cleaner to remove soil from the coupons.
